How Do Automatic Driveway Gates Operate?
Automatic driveway gates are a convenient way to control access to your property. Unlike manual gates, which require you to get out of your car to open and close them, automatic gates can be opened and closed with the push of a button. Automatic gates are operated by a motor, which is powered by either electricity or batteries. The motor is connected to the gate via a chain, belt, or gear system. When the motor is activated, it turns the chain, belt, or gears, which opens or closes the gate. Automatic driveway gates can be installed as either swing gates or slide gates. Swing gates are hinged on one side and open like a door, while slide gates run on a track and open by sliding sideways. Automatic driveway gates can also be equipped with a number of additional features, such as sensors that detect when an object is in the way of the closing gate, and timers that automatically close the gate after a set amount of time.

Security and Privacy
Automatic driveway gates offer a number of advantages over traditional manually operated gates. Perhaps the most obvious benefit is the increased level of security they provide. Automatic gates can be designed to open only when authorized persons are present, using electronic keypads, remote controls, or other methods. This helps to deter intruders and keep unwanted visitors out.
Automatic driveway gates can also be integrated with other security systems, such as CCTV cameras, to provide an even higher level of protection.
Tall driveway gates provide security and seclusion, as long as the barriers are completely opaque and do not have slats or are transparent. This means you may ensure that anyone who passes your driveway can’t look inside, especially if you have youngsters in your yard.
Ease of access
Automated driveway gates might be a real-life saver, especially during the wettest days of winter. With an automated gate, you can open and close the gate without ever leaving your car. This is especially beneficial if you have a large or busy driveway. Automatic gates can also be programmed to open and close at specific times, which can be helpful in managing traffic flow. Additionally, automated gates can be equipped with sensors that detect when a car is approaching and open the gate automatically. This can be a great convenience if you frequently have visitors.

Power Outages
It goes without saying that automatic security gates need electricity to function. You might expect to be trapped indoors or outside your property during a power outage, waiting until the electricity comes back on so you can open the gate. Fortunately, many modern solutions include a backup power generator or a battery pack to ensure that the system remains operational should the electricity go out. Consider investing in a solar-powered gate opener to ensure that you will never be stuck because of the lack of electricity.
Potential Danger
An incorrectly placed automated gate might be quite dangerous, putting someone’s life at risk. You’ve undoubtedly heard about people getting trapped and crushed by automatic gates on the news. Small children and oblivious visitors are particularly prone to harm from these motorized systems.
Fortunately, advances in automatic security gates have made them considerably safer to operate. Modern automatic systems, for example, may have sensors that trigger and retract when they come across anything in the way. Sliding gates also include safety edges, speed controls, and safety bollards. These features are intended to guarantee that the automatic gates are safe to use.
